Underpinning Repair in Tampa, FL
Underpinning repair services involve strengthening and stabilizing the foundation of a property when signs of settling, shifting, or structural movement become apparent. This process typically includes installing additional support beneath the existing foundation to prevent further damage and ensure the stability of the structure. Common projects include addressing uneven floors, cracked walls, or foundation settlement caused by soil movement or moisture issues. Property owners often seek underpinning when they notice signs of foundation distress or plan renovations that require a stable base, making it essential to understand the scope of work, potential causes of foundation problems, and the importance of proper assessment before proceeding.
Before requesting underpinning services, homeowners should consider the specific signs indicating foundation issues, such as cracks in walls or uneven flooring, and understand the potential causes related to soil conditions or moisture levels. It is also helpful to know the extent of the foundation's movement and whether other structural repairs are needed. Clarifying the types of underpinning methods available and how they impact the property can assist in making informed decisions. Ensuring a thorough evaluation by a qualified specialist can help determine the most appropriate repair approach to restore stability and protect the property's long-term integrity.

Common Underpinning Repair Jobs
Foundation underpinning - stabilizes and strengthens compromised foundation structures.
Pier and beam repair - addresses shifting or settling of pier and beam supports.
Slab stabilization - prevents uneven settling and cracks in concrete slabs.
Structural reinforcement - restores the integrity of weakened foundation elements.
Crack repair - seals foundation c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.
Soil stabilization - improves soil conditions to reduce future foundation movement.
Underpinning Repair Questions
What is underpinning repair? Underpinning repair involves strengthening or stabilizing the foundation of a building to prevent further settling or damage.
When is underpinning necessary? Underpinning is needed when signs like foundation cracks, uneven floors, or doors and windows that don’t close properly appear.
What methods are used in underpinning? Common methods include installing additional support piers or underpinning piles beneath the existing foundation.
How does underpinning improve property stability? It restores the foundation’s strength, reducing movement and preventing future structural issues.
